Philip Roth Studies, a peer-reviewed semiannual journal published by Purdue University Press in cooperation with the Philip Roth Society, welcomes all writing pertaining entirely or in part to Philip Roth, his fiction, and his literary and cultural significance.

David Brauner

David Brauner is a renowned literary scholar known for his groundbreaking work on Jewish-American literature. His book "Post-War Jewish Fiction: Ambivalence, Self-Explanation and Transatlantic Connections" explores the complexities of Jewish identity and culture in the aftermath of World War II. Brauner's insightful analysis has greatly enriched the field of literature.
